Let's talk about two methods of repeating timers in JavaScript

Apr 24, 2023 pm 03:50 PM

Repeat timer method JavaScript

In web development, timers are often used, such as to implement timer functions and dynamic effects. Sometimes, when we need to execute a function or code regularly and repeatedly, we can use a repeat timer to achieve this.

JavaScript provides two methods for repeating timers, namely setInterval() and setTimeout(). Below we will introduce the use and precautions of these two methods.

setInterval() method

The setInterval() method is used to repeatedly execute the specified function or code at intervals.

Syntax:

setInterval(function, interval);

Where function is the function or code to be executed, and interval is the number of milliseconds between executions. It should be noted that the value of the interval parameter must be greater than 0.

For example:

var i = 0;
setInterval(function(){
    console.log(i);
    i++;
}, 1000);

The function of this code snippet is to output a number every 1 second, starting from 0 and increasing in sequence.

setTimeout() method

The setTimeout() method has a similar function to the setInterval() method, and also implements the function of repeated timing. The difference is that the setTimeout() method will only execute the function or code once. You need to call the setTimeout() method again after the function or code is executed to achieve the effect of repeated execution.

Syntax:

setTimeout(function, interval);

Where function is the function or code to be executed, and interval is the number of milliseconds between executions. It should be noted that the value of the interval parameter must be greater than 0.

For example:

var i = 0;
function repeat(){
    console.log(i);
    i++;
    setTimeout(repeat, 1000);
}
repeat();

The function of this code snippet is similar to the previous example. It also outputs a number every second, but uses a recursive method to achieve repeated timing.

Notes

While using the repeat timer, you need to consider a few points:

  1. Don’t forget to clear the timer: when the page is unloaded, Be sure to clear all timers, otherwise page performance will be affected.
  2. Don’t ignore the execution time: The execution time of the repeat timer is not precise, and the execution time error needs to be taken into account.
  3. Don’t overuse: Excessive use of timers will affect page performance. It is recommended to use them reasonably as needed.
